Responsibilities:
• Lead and supervise a crew in the installation of water and sewer pipelines and related underground utility work.
• Oversee the installation of pipe, manholes, valves, hydrants, fittings, services, and other utility structures.
• Read and interpret project plans, specifications, blueprints, cut sheets, and complex diagrams.
• Carry and maintain grade using pipe laser equipment and other grade-control tools.
• Coordinate daily work activities, materials, equipment, and crew production.
• Operate or assist with equipment operation, including backhoes, track hoes, excavators, and front-end loaders when needed.
• Ensure proper installation and use of trench shoring, trench boxes, sloping, and other excavation safety measures.
• Confirm that company safety standards and procedures are followed by employees and subcontractors.
• Communicate with superintendents, project managers, inspectors, subcontractors, and other field personnel.
• Assist with manual labor when required to help the crew complete the work.
• Professionally represent the company to coworkers, owners, engineers, inspectors, subcontractors, and the general public.
